Asthma is a chronic respiratory condition that affects millions of people worldwide, posing significant challenges in managing symptoms and maintaining a healthy lifestyle. However, the emergence of innovative approaches, such as gamification, has revolutionized the way individuals with asthma can take control of their condition and achieve better health outcomes.

Gamification, the integration of game-like elements into non-game contexts, has proven to be an effective tool in enhancing asthma management. By incorporating elements such as points, rewards, and competition, these gamified platforms have successfully engaged and motivated individuals to actively participate in their own healthcare journey.

One such success story comes from Sarah, a 35-year-old marketing executive who has been living with asthma since childhood. "I always found it difficult to stay on top of my asthma treatment plan, but that all changed when I discovered a gamified app," she shares. "The app turned my daily medication routine into a fun and rewarding experience. I earned points for taking my medications on time, and I could even compete with friends who also have asthma. It made managing my condition feel less like a chore and more like a game I could actually win."

Sarah's experience is not unique. Many individuals have reported positive outcomes from incorporating gamification into their asthma management strategies. For example, Alex, a 28-year-old student, found that the use of a gamified asthma tracker helped him better understand his triggers and patterns, allowing him to make informed decisions about his treatment plan.

"The app gave me real-time feedback on my symptoms, and I could even see how my performance improved over time," Alex explains. "It was incredibly motivating to see my 'asthma score' get better as I stuck to my prescribed treatment. The sense of accomplishment made me more engaged and proactive in managing my condition."

The success of these gamified approaches lies in their ability to foster a sense of ownership and empowerment among individuals with asthma. By making the management process more interactive and rewarding, these platforms encourage users to actively participate in their own care, leading to better adherence to medication regimens and improved overall asthma control.

Furthermore, the social aspect of many gamified asthma apps allows users to connect with others facing similar challenges, creating a supportive community that can further enhance the management experience. Sharing success stories and celebrating milestones with peers can provide a sense of camaraderie and motivation, inspiring others to adopt these transformative approaches.

As more individuals with asthma discover the benefits of gamification, the potential for improved health outcomes and better quality of life becomes increasingly evident. By harnessing the power of technology and game-like elements, the management of this chronic condition can be transformed, empowering individuals to take control of their health and achieve remarkable success stories.
